17 d’abril de 2011

Error ssl_error_renegotiation_not_allowed al Firefox 4, sol·lucionat !

Si, com espero, ja us heu passat al Firefox 4 i treballeu amb pàgines segures o banca per internet, possiblement us haureu trobat amb un error similar al següent:


L'error es produeix perquè Firefox 4 ha decidit no permetre la renegociació SSL per evitar un atac conegut com "man-in-the-middle", que consisteix en interceptar en algun punt mig les comunicacions segures entre el client i el servidor. I llavors, utilitzar les credencials de la víctima (client) per enganyar el servidor.

El problema és que hi ha pàgines legals que utilitzen la renegociació SSL per redireccionar en els seus propis servidors, i ara ja no hi podrem accedir. I si es tracta del banc amb el que operem normalment... tenim un problema.

La solució passa per escriure a la barra de direcció:
about:config
Això ens obrirà una finestra advertint-nos que tocarem coses que poden ser perilloses per a la configuració del Firefox, així que anirem en compte.


Amb això accedim a tota la configuració del Firefox.


[1] L'adreça que hem utilitzat per accedir a la configuració.
[2] Filtrem els resultats per trobar els que ens interessen.
[3] La solució clàssica que es troba per internet, indica que cal posar aquesta variable a true. No ho feu! Això habilitaria la renegociació en tots els casos. Per tant, deixaríeu el navegador vulnerable als atacs man-in-the-middle.
[4] La solució bona passa per habilitar només els servidors que necessitem (en els que hem tingut problemes), deixant la resta ben protegits. Només cal que entrem les seves adreces en aquesta variable.

Amb això ja ho tenim tot configurat, i podrem accedir a la pàgina/operació desitjada sense problemes.

15 d’abril de 2011

Kindle DX 9.7" 3G posat a casa per 272 € [Oferta finalitzada]

Acabo de rebre una magnífica oferta des d'Amazon: El Kindle DX de 9,7" i amb 3G, posat a casa per 272 €, i just a temps per Sant Jordi.


Això són uns 70 € menys. Si us interessa, aprofiteu-lo de seguida, que crec que només durarà un dia !

Edició a 17/04/2011: L'oferta s'ha acabat, i ara torna a estar al seu preu normal de 340€.

10 d’abril de 2011

Actualizant Wine a la darrera beta (1.3.17)

Avui m'he trobat que la versió de Wine, l'aplicatiu que ens permet executar programes Windows des de Linux, tenia problemes gràfics amb cert programa. Jo estava utilitzant la versió estable que ens ve en els repositoris per defecte (1.2.3). La solució, lògicament, ha passat per actualizar-lo a la darrera versió en desenvolupament, actualment la 1.3.17.

Per fer-ho, podem utilitzar un repositori PPA amb la següent comanda:
$ sudo add-apt-repository ppa:ubuntu-wine/ppa && \
  sudo apt-get update && \
  sudo apt-get install wine1.3 && \

Al cap d'uns moments, problema solucionat!

2 d’abril de 2011

CrystalHD amb suport oficial a FFmpeg i MPlayer

Molt bones notícies pels que tenim una targeta d'acceleració de vídeo CrystalHD (BCM70015) ja que finalment el seu suport s'ha integrat a les versions oficials de FFmpeg i MPlayer!

Recordem que les targetes CrystalHD ens serveixen per poder reproduir vídeo HD en ordinadors poc potents, basats en Atom i GMA950 o similars. Fins ara, poder afegir el suport a CrystalHD a MPlayer era possible, però no era senzill. En canvi, a partir d'ara podrem fer servir directament les versions oficials:
$ cd ~ && \
  svn checkout svn://svn.mplayerhq.hu/mplayer/trunk mplayer && \
  cd mplayer && \
  ./configure

En aquest punt, hem de comprovar que no hi ha cap error i que ens apareix el CrystalHD com a suportat. Si no és així, possiblement ens manca obtenir i compilar la darrera versió dels controladors. Mireu que us aparegui la línia següent en algun punt del terminal:
Checking for CrystalHD ... yes 
Si tot ha anat bé, ja podem compilar (paciència, trigarà una estona) i instal·lar el MPlayer.
$ ./configure --enable-gui && \
  make && \
  sudo make install
Amb això ja tenim el MPlayer funcionant amb acceleració per la CrystalHD. Però per assegurar-nos que l'utilitzarà per defecte, hem d'editar també el fitxer de configuració del MPlayer:
$ gedit ~/.mplayer/config &
I hi afegim les opcions següents:
# Write your default config options here!
vc=ffmpeg12crystalhd,ffodivxcrystalhd,ffh264crystalhd,ffvc1crystalhd,
Sobretot, fixeu-vos que hi ha una coma al final i no la traieu, ja que sinó fallaria l'autodetecció del tipus de fitxer.

I, ara sí, a guadir-ne!


Finalment, recordar que de tant en tant pot ser convenient actualitzar el codi per seguir l'evolució del MPlayer. Ho podem fer amb la comanda següent i tornant a compilar:
$ cd ~/mplayer && \
  svn up && \
  make distclean